Output 3244ab41c60aa01323e89ffed53405fa6ee1ecf57942291df1f8d717776f1d5a:15

value
377268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 790810f6e9dfc3dba4b5f4f2652eda07c49efca3 OP_EQUAL
address
3CiyMD6T392QNa1kzxoNDP9ELdeabL4Pqw
transaction
3244ab41c60aa01323e89ffed53405fa6ee1ecf57942291df1f8d717776f1d5a